Transaction 58bf674018e9a9ec6630f1582a350310ca193859d902ede80959003c794f54b5
1 Input
1 Output
-
58bf674018e9a9ec6630f1582a350310ca193859d902ede80959003c794f54b5:0
- value
- 409259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aecc600f0ccae470556fc0fb8469a1cbdf05402 OP_EQUAL
- address
- 38XBa3gXkgNU6gS2teh8BNs27MBiMjF6hz